Do any of you have religious tattoos? If not would you ever get one? What would you like?

I've always wanted the sacred heart (in colour) on the underside of my left wrist and perhaps, depending how stuff works out, the words "fiat mihi secundum verbum tuum" (be it done unto me according to thy word) on my right. One for Jesus and one for Mary :D
